Been working on my 10/22 to see how accurate it can be. Well after several modifications, I found the gun is a lot better than I am. I recently added a drop in single stage trigger by Kidd.
I'm not a great shot but today I found that the gun likes Eley and SK Standard Plus . I was able to shoot three groups today with Eley ,the worst group at .490" center to center spread from 50 yds. That is good for me. New trigger pull is 2.2 lbs measured with my Lyman digital gage. Feels lighter than that. Very nice addition.
